Pt90Ir10 Tubes are precision-fabricated tubing composed of a platinum-iridium alloy with nominal composition 90% platinum and 10% iridium (Pt 90/Ir 10). This alloy tube is engineered for applications demanding exceptional chemical inertness, high temperature stability and robust mechanical performance in harsh service environments. With melting point around 1800 °C, density ~21.56 g/cm³, and tensile strength in the 380–620 MPa range, Pt90Ir10 tubing offers a unique combination of corrosion resistance, high purity and dimensional integrity. Whether used in aerospace propulsion systems, medical implants, high-temperature furnace assemblies or ultra-clean fluid transport in chemical processing, these Pt90Ir10 Tubes deliver reliable performance where conventional alloys fail.
Below is a representative specification table for Pt90Ir10 Tubes. Actual values may vary depending on manufacture route, temper and size.
| Parameter | Value / Range |
|---|---|
| Chemical composition (nominal) | Pt 90 % / Ir 10 % |
| Density | ~21.56 g/cm³ |
| Melting point | Approx. 1800 °C |
| Tensile strength (Rm) | ~380–620 MPa |
| Hardness (Brinell) | ~130–190 HB |
| Elongation at break | <25% |
| Electrical resistivity | ~25 µΩ·cm |
| Thermal conductivity | ~31 W/m·K at 23 °C |
| Coefficient of thermal expansion | ~8.7×10⁻⁶ K⁻¹ (20-100 °C) |
| Typical outer diameter (OD) | e.g., 0.56 mm |
| Typical wall thickness | e.g., 0.13 mm |

The Pt90Ir10 Tubes are highly suited for a variety of demanding applications across global markets:
Chemical processing: Used for ultra-pure fluid or gas delivery in corrosive media, thanks to excellent chemical inertness.
Medical & biomedical devices: Ideal for long-term implantable leads, electrode housings and micro-tubing in neurostimulation or cardiac systems (especially relevant for South-East Asia, Middle East medical device OEMs).
Aerospace & propulsion: Suitable for high-temperature thermocouple sheaths, sensor housings and small structural tubing in jet-engine components.
Electronics & instrumentation: High-purity micro-tubing for high-end sensors, connectors and microscale precision devices.
Research & advanced energy: Fuel-cell components, high-temperature reactors, and instrumentation in North America and Europe that demand both chemical stability and purity.
Q1: What makes Pt90Ir10 Tubes different from standard platinum tubing?
A1: The addition of 10% iridium significantly increases mechanical strength and high-temperature stability compared with pure platinum, while retaining platinum’s superior corrosion resistance and chemical inertness. As a result, Pt90Ir10 Tubes are better suited for extreme environments.
Q2: Can I get custom diameters or wall thicknesses for Pt90Ir10 Tubes?
A2: Yes — many producers offer custom OD/ID and wall thickness specifications (for example OD 0.3 mm minimum, wall thickness as low as 0.015 mm in capillary versions) tailored for micro-fluidic or implantable device use.

Q4: How do I verify quality and performance of Pt90Ir10 Tubes?
A4: Request a Certificate of Analysis (COA) with actual chemical composition (Pt/Ir ratio), tensile/hardness test results, dimensional tolerances, and material condition (annealed, as-drawn). Cross-check with industry references: for example, Pt90Ir10 alloy is documented with hardness ~130-190 HB and tensile ~380-620 MPa.
